The Tyrant of the Dodekathon Warlord trait is one of three Iron Warrior-specific warlords traits. He is restricted to only being on foot, though so no bike jetbike or jump pack for him. The upgrade gives the character a Servo Arm, a cortex controller, Master of Automata and Battlesmith (3+). This upgrade existed in HH 1.0 but it cost 35pts, its now only 20pts. The Warsmith upgrade for Iron Warriors is a special Preator upgrade available only to the Iron Warriors legion.
